About 266a
266a is a two-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Dagenham (RM9 4AT). It has a recorded floor area of 57 m² (around 614 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(September 2019) shows a C (score 71). The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since March 2009.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Good to Average and window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 87).
It changed hands recently, sold January 2025 for £450,000. At 57 m² it's 15.9%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(68 m² median across 42 EPCs).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 83% of similar EPCs). Across 2005–2025, sale prices on this property compounded at 5%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£733/sq ft) was about 227.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
